As it stands nowadays, individual states are free to prohibit or practice gambling of their borders while significant regulations and limits are put on interstate which activity. Recently, online game playing has seen harsher regulations. With the Unlawful World wide web Gambling Enforcement Act of 2006 (UIEGA), it was not explicitly banned but rather it had been online financial transactions that were outlawed. This meant that online financial dealings from gambling providers were now illegal which led to various offshore gambling operators excluding US customers from their services.

Existing in this lawful grey area, it is no longer a problem of if online gambling will enter in the US market but when and perhaps how. As recently as this month, three claims own legalized online gambling and intend to begin offering bets by the end of the year. Naturally, a gaming company in Las Vegas known as Ultimate Gaming was the first ever to offer online poker but for now restricting it to sole players in Nevada. New Jersey and Delaware have also legalized online gambling and so far ten other states are thinking about legalizing it in a few form or another.

Frank Fahrenkopf, president of the American Games Association has explained that “Unless there is a federal bill passed, we will have the greatest expansion of legalized gambling in the United States. I don’t believe that’s what anyone intended, but it is what we’re witnessing.” This poses a great deal of questions and of course concerns for most existing commercial casinos and also American policy makers. Will lawful online gambling mean fewer persons in offline casinos? Will this create a new source of revenue at hawaii and national level? What about taxes and regulations? An increase in gamblers?

Lots of people including Arnie Wexler, previous chairman of New Jersey’s Council On Compulsive Gambling provides voiced concern that with all the good this could do to generate income and revenue for specific states there could be problems with an increase in compulsive gambling. There is particular concern regarding social media marketing in america as some locations like Zynga have previously begun taking real-money bets.
